The investigation focuses on alleged misuse of European Union funds allocated to the group during the period from 2019 to 2024.<\/p>\n<h3>Alleged Misappropriation of Funds<\/h3>\n<p>According to reports from Efe, the investigation revolves around an alleged misappropriation of <strong>4.33 million euros<\/strong> that the European Parliament issued for the group&#8217;s operational expenses. Various dubious expenditures have been identified, including donations to entities that seem unrelated to the political activities of the ID, as well as contracts awarded to businesses linked to the involved parties. Information sourced from the French newspaper <em>Le Monde<\/em> indicates that this investigation ties back to a case opened in July 2025, prompted by a report from the Directorate of Financial Affairs of the European Parliament. The operations are being coordinated by the Central Office for the Fight against Corruption and Financial and Tax Crimes, which is collaborating with various other agencies across Europe.<\/p>\n<h3>Past Convictions and Legal Troubles<\/h3>\n<p>Interestingly, this is not the first time Marine Le Pen and her party, the <strong>National Rally (RN)<\/strong>, have faced legal troubles regarding the misuse of European Parliament resources. In a previous case, they were tried and convicted, leading to Le Pen&#8217;s disqualification last year. Current legal proceedings are pending an appeal decision scheduled for <strong>July 7<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<h3>Carbon Footprint of Political Campaigns?<\/h3>\n<p>In addition to the wealth of information regarding questionable funding practices, Jordan Bardella, the president of the RN, stated that searches have been conducted at both headquarters and the private residences of communication service providers collaborating with the group. This company is known to regularly supply services for the RN\u2019s campaigns. Reports indicate that the company&#8217;s founder, <strong>Paul-Alexandre Martin<\/strong>, is also under scrutiny, adding another layer to the complex narrative surrounding the misuse of EU funds.<\/p>\n<h3>Conclusion<\/h3>\n<p>The unfolding story surrounding the Identity and Democracy party and the alleged misuse of European funds serves as a critical reminder of the need for oversight in the use of public resources.
